The Pragmatic Programmer
The Pragmatic Programmer: Your Journey To Mastery, 20th Anniversary Edition (2nd Edition)
If you are a programmer looking to level up your skills and become a true master in your craft, then “The Pragmatic Programmer: Your Journey To Mastery” is this book for you. This 20th Anniversary Edition, now in its 2nd edition, is a timeless classic that continues to inspire and guide programmers around the world.
Written by Andrew Hunt and David Thomas, two experienced software developers and authors, the book is packed with practical advice and insights that will revolutionize the way you approach programming. It is not just about writing code, but about becoming a pragmatic programmer who can solve complex problems efficiently and effectively.
One of the key strengths of this book is its focus on timeless principles and concepts that are applicable to any programming language or technology. The authors emphasize the importance of code simplicity, readability, and maintainability, and provide concrete examples and techniques to achieve these goals.
Throughout this book, you’ll find numerous real-world anecdotes and case studies that illustrate the challenges faced by programmers and how they can be overcome. From debugging and testing to version control and software architecture, the authors cover a wide range of topics that are essential for every programmer’s toolkit.
What sets this book apart from others is its emphasis on the human side of programming. The authors understand that programming is not just about writing code, but also about working effectively with others, managing your time, and continuously learning and improving your skills. They provide valuable advice on communication, teamwork, and personal development that will help you thrive in any programming environment.
Whether you are a beginner just starting your programming journey or an advanced developer looking to take your skills to the next level, “The Pragmatic Programmer: Your Journey To Mastery” is a must-read. It’s a book that you’ll keep coming back to throughout your career, as its timeless wisdom and practical advice will continue to resonate with you. So grab a copy, dive in, and embark on your journey to becoming a pragmatic programmer.